Immediate Actions - Do These NOW

The pressure gauge on your boiler tells you how much force the water in your central heating system is under. Most boilers - including popular models from Worcester Bosch, Vaillant, Ideal, and Baxi - are designed to run at between 1 and 1.5 bar when the system is cold. Below 0.5 bar, the boiler will typically lock out and refuse to fire. That is the boiler protecting itself, not a catastrophic failure.

Here is what to do, step by step:

  1. Check the pressure gauge. Is it below 1 bar or below 0.5 bar? Note the exact reading - your engineer will ask for it. If the boiler has already locked out, you will likely see a fault code on the display panel alongside the low pressure indicator.
  2. Write down any error codes. Worcester Bosch units commonly display E9 or F1 for pressure-related faults. Viessmann models may show F4. These codes narrow down the diagnosis significantly before anyone even opens the casing.
  3. Look for visible leaks. Walk the pipework you can see - around radiators, valves, and the boiler itself. Look for damp patches, rust staining, or water sitting on the floor. Even a very slow drip can cause measurable pressure loss over 24 to 48 hours.
  4. Find the filling loop. This is typically a braided silver hose or a set of inline valves beneath the boiler. If you cannot locate it, check your boiler manual or look up the model number online. Do not improvise with an unfamiliar connection.
  5. Repressurize carefully. Open the filling loop valves slowly and watch the gauge as the pressure rises. Stop at around 1.2 bar. Do not overshoot - running above 2.75 bar puts unnecessary stress on the pressure relief valve and can trigger a secondary problem.
  6. Restart and monitor. If the pressure holds steady for 48 hours with no fault codes returning, you may have had a one-off drop caused by a recent bleed or minor air release. If it drops again, stop topping it up and call an engineer.

What NOT to Do

This is where many homeowners in Havant make problems considerably worse. A few mistakes come up again and again on call-outs across Hampshire.

Do not keep topping up the pressure without finding the cause. Filling the system repeatedly masks an underlying fault. If you have topped it up more than once in a single week, something is wrong. Continuing to add water can also dilute the inhibitor chemicals that protect the system from internal corrosion, creating a longer-term problem on top of the immediate one.

Do not ignore water near the boiler. A puddle or persistent damp patch at the base of a boiler is not normal. It could point to a failing heat exchanger, a weeping pressure relief valve, or a loose internal connection. Left alone, water damage to surrounding joinery and structure adds cost to what might otherwise have been a contained repair.

Do not attempt to replace any gas-carrying components yourself. Under UK law, any work on a gas appliance must be carried out by a Gas Safe registered engineer - this is a legal requirement, not a recommendation. A Gas Safe engineer carries an ID card with a unique registration number you can verify at gassaferegister.co.uk. The rule exists because incorrectly handled gas fittings can result in carbon monoxide leaks or fire. Do not cut corners here.

Do not overfill the system. If you push the pressure above 3 bar, the pressure relief valve will open to release the excess and water will discharge through an external overflow pipe - typically visible as dripping from a small pipe on the outside wall. If you see this, do not simply top the pressure back up. Something caused the spike in the first place, and repeating the fill without finding the cause will trigger the same response.

What the Emergency Repair Involves

When an engineer arrives, the first job is confirming where the pressure is going. This is not always obvious even to an experienced eye. Common causes include the following.

Faulty pressure relief valve (PRV). The PRV is a safety device that opens if system pressure climbs too high. When it starts to weep or fails to seat properly, it bleeds pressure away continuously - often draining outside through an overflow pipe. Replacing a PRV on most common boiler models typically costs between 150 and 300 pounds including parts and labour, though it varies by brand and how accessible the component is inside the casing.

Internal heat exchanger leak. Hairline cracks or pinhole corrosion in the heat exchanger allow water to escape inside the boiler - sometimes evaporating on hot surfaces and leaving no visible trace. Heat exchanger replacement on a mid-range boiler commonly falls between 350 and 650 pounds. On boilers over ten years old, this cost can come close to the price of a new unit, and an honest engineer will tell you that upfront before you commit to the repair.

Radiator valve or pipework leak. A dripping valve, a weeping compression fitting, or a pinhole in older copper pipework can all cause slow but steady pressure loss. Depending on location and complexity, fixing this kind of leak typically costs between 80 and 200 pounds.

Failed expansion vessel. The expansion vessel absorbs the pressure change as water heats and cools. When it loses its charge or the internal membrane fails, pressure climbs too high when the system is hot and drops when it cools. Recharging or replacing the expansion vessel typically costs between 100 and 250 pounds, making it one of the more accessible fixes when caught early.

Every one of these repairs must be carried out by a Gas Safe registered engineer. Before leaving, the engineer should run the system up to temperature, check operating pressure across the range, and confirm no further leaks are present.

Emergency Questions

Why does my boiler keep losing pressure even after I top it up?

Repeated pressure loss after topping up almost always means there is either a leak somewhere in the system or a component - commonly the pressure relief valve or expansion vessel - has failed. The water has to go somewhere. In some cases the leak is extremely slow and only shows up as a faint damp patch on a pipe joint, inside a radiator panel, or within the boiler casing itself. Stop filling the system and arrange for a Gas Safe registered engineer to trace the source properly, as continually adding water dilutes the inhibitor chemicals protecting your system from internal corrosion.

Is it safe to use the heating while boiler pressure is low?

If the pressure has dropped below 0.5 bar, most boilers will already have locked out and will not fire - so the question answers itself. Between 0.5 and 1 bar, the boiler may still run but the system is not circulating correctly, meaning some radiators will stay cold and the boiler works less efficiently than it should. You can repressurize to around 1.2 bar and run the heating while you arrange for an engineer to investigate, but do not keep refilling if the pressure continues to drop - that is masking a fault, not fixing it.

How much does an emergency boiler repair cost in Havant?

Emergency call-out fees in Havant and across the Hampshire area typically range from 80 to 150 pounds on top of parts and labour. The total cost depends entirely on what is causing the pressure loss. A PRV replacement might come to 150 to 300 pounds all in. A heat exchanger repair can reach 400 to 650 pounds. An expansion vessel fix commonly lands between 100 and 250 pounds. Any reputable Gas Safe registered engineer should give you a clear, fixed quote before starting work - if they will not, that is a reason to pause and get a second opinion.

Can a boiler lose pressure without any visible leak?

Yes, and it happens more often than people expect. Leaks can occur inside the boiler casing itself - around internal heat exchanger joints, the PRV body, or pipework connections you cannot reach without opening the unit. Water dripping onto a hot surface may evaporate before it can pool, leaving no visible trace.
